What is a verb?
A verb is a word that expresses an action, occurrence, or state of being. It is the part of speech that conveys the main idea or action in a sentence and can show tense, mood, or voice to indicate when the action is happening, the attitude of the speaker, or the relationship between the subject and the action.
Give an example of a verb.
Run" is an example of a verb.
How do verbs show action?
Verbs show action by expressing what the subject of a sentence is doing. They convey a sense of activity or movement, portraying actions that are being performed. Verbs can indicate physical actions, mental actions, or states of being, helping to provide the necessary context and dynamism to sentences.
Can verbs also show a state of being or existence? Give an example.
Yes, verbs can also show a state of being or existence. One example of this is the verb "to be." For instance, in the sentence "I am happy," the verb "am" indicates a state of being (happy) rather than an action.
What is the past tense of a verb?
The past tense of a verb indicates an action that has already occurred in the past. It is formed by adding the appropriate ending to the base form of the verb, indicating that the action happened before the current moment.
How do you make a verb past tense?
To make a verb past tense, you typically add "-ed" to the base form of the verb. However, there are irregular verbs that do not follow this rule and must be memorized individually.
What is the present tense of a verb?
The present tense of a verb indicates actions that are happening now or regularly. It is the form of the verb that represents the current time, showing an action that is ongoing or habitual.
How do you make a verb present tense?
To make a verb present tense, add the base form of the verb to the sentence without any additional endings or modifications. For example, the base form of the verb "run" is "run," so to make it present tense, simply use "run" in the sentence, such as "I run every morning.
What is the future tense of a verb?
The future tense of a verb indicates that an action will happen in the future. It is formed by using the auxiliary verb "will" or "shall" followed by the base form of the verb. For example, "I will travel to Europe next month.
How do you make a verb future tense?
To make a verb future tense in English, you typically add the modal verb "will" before the base form of the verb. For example, "I will eat" or "She will go". Another way to form the future tense is by using the phrase "going to" + base form of the verb, such as "They are going to study".
